A Booming Market Amidst Personal Struggles
While PACS Group Inc. faces internal challenges, the broader healthcare IT sector is thriving. The enterprise imaging IT market, valued at $2.31 billion in 2025, is projected to reach $4.12 bill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 12.2%. This growth is driven by the increasing demand for cross-specialty image access in oncology and cardiology, alongside the integration of advanced visualization tools like 3D and cinematic imaging. Industry Leaders Set the Pace
In contrast to PACS Group Inc.’s struggles, companies like Pro Medicus are setting industry benchmarks. Pro Medicus reported a 31.9% increase in revenue, reaching $213.0 million for the fiscal year 2025. Their underlying profit before tax surged by 40.2%, and the company remains debt-free with cash and other financial assets totaling $210.7 million. These results reflect a year of record contract wins and strategic growth, positioning Pro Medicus as a leader in enterprise imaging and radiology information systems.
